  • Windows XP will not be closed. I have to press the power button to turn it off.

    original title: WINDOWS XP WONT SHUT DOWN - I HAVE power to the BOTTOM BY pressing POWER BUTTON COMPUTER

    WINDOWS XP DOES NOT - STOP I HAVE TO POWER COMPUTER DOWN BY PRESSING THE POWER BUTTON

    I had a computer that had posted these symptoms.

    In the end, I did the following:

    1. in Control Panel, "Power Options."

    2. click on the "tab APM" " ".»

    3. check "Enable Advanced Power Management Support"

    4. click on OK

    Check the result.

    Reference: http://support.microsoft.com/kb/313290

  • Help - HP Pavilion a6030.uk desktop computer. Have to press the power button several times to start?

    Hello

    I have a HP desktop computer. The model is HP Pavilion a6030.uk, Opertating system: windows vista.

    My computer has had no problems at all until yesterday for some reason, I had to push the switch several times to start until he finally turned and did normal starts. As I would press the power as normal to start button, but all of a sudden, it turns off after about 2 seconds and so I would tap on the switch several times and each time it will not start and turn off, then the power button could be pressed again until it would finally turn on and start and run as normal and seems to work correctly. And it was the same thing today, I pressed the power button mutiple times (for example 6 times) until she finally started as usual.

    Savvy/computer im not very well informed or wise in this area, please someone will help me and give me some advice/help to fix/resolve this problem.

    Thank you for taking the time to read this and any help would be appreciated for this problem.

    Thank you.

    Vonbon90, welcome to the forum.

    When I see these symptoms on an old computer, I think it may be a power supply (PSU) failure/ing.  Here's a guide that will help your troubleshooting it.

    In addition, you could test the memory.  This can be done by removing all modules of memory and replacing them one at the time and start.
